This text continues to offer cutting-edge analysis of contemporary schooling in America from a critical perspective. Provides up-to-the-minute critical analysis of the way schools really work that takes into account both historical influences and current critical theory. Includes extensive coverage of race, class, and gender and their roles in relation to power dynamics in todayOs classrooms. Wide ranging content draws on social theory as well as the sociology of organizations, of work and the professions, and of knowledge. ...
